The Malaysian Estates Staff Provident Fund, 1947-2017 Malaysia's oldest provident fund : with an economic, social and political perspective

In this book, Jerayaj C. Rajarao provides a detailed and compelling account of the first provident fund established in Malaya through co-operation between plantation companies, the All Malayan Estates Staff Union and the then colonial government of Malaya.
